Partilhar via


SentenceSimilarityTrainer.SentenceSimilarityOptions Classe

Definição

public class SentenceSimilarityTrainer.SentenceSimilarityOptions : Microsoft.ML.TorchSharp.NasBert.NasBertTrainer.NasBertOptions
type SentenceSimilarityTrainer.SentenceSimilarityOptions = class
    inherit NasBertTrainer.NasBertOptions
Public Class SentenceSimilarityTrainer.SentenceSimilarityOptions
Inherits NasBertTrainer.NasBertOptions
Herança
SentenceSimilarityTrainer.SentenceSimilarityOptions

Construtores

SentenceSimilarityTrainer.SentenceSimilarityOptions()

Campos

ActivationDropout

Taxa de desativação após funções de ativação em camadas FFN. Deve estar dentro de [0, 1).

(Herdado de NasBertTrainer.NasBertOptions)
AdamBetas

Betas para o otimizador adam.

(Herdado de NasBertTrainer.NasBertOptions)
AdamEps

Otimizador Epsilon para Adam.

(Herdado de NasBertTrainer.NasBertOptions)
AttentionDropout

Taxa de abandono para pesos de atenção. Deve estar dentro de [0, 1).

(Herdado de NasBertTrainer.NasBertOptions)
BatchSize

Número de exemplos a serem usados para treinamento em minilote.

(Herdado de TorchSharpBaseTrainer.Options)
ClipNorm

O limite de recorte de gradientes. Deve estar dentro de [0, +Inf). 0 significa não cortar a norma.

(Herdado de NasBertTrainer.NasBertOptions)
Dropout

Taxa de descarte para situações gerais. Deve estar dentro de [0, 1).

(Herdado de NasBertTrainer.NasBertOptions)
DynamicDropout

Se você deve usar a esmissão dinâmica.

(Herdado de NasBertTrainer.NasBertOptions)
EncoderNormalizeBefore

Se deve aplicar a normalização de camada antes de cada bloco de codificador.

(Herdado de NasBertTrainer.NasBertOptions)
FinalLearningRateRatio

A taxa de aprendizado final para o agendador de decaimento polinomial.

(Herdado de TorchSharpBaseTrainer.Options)
FreezeEncoder

Se os parâmetros do codificador devem ser congelados.

(Herdado de NasBertTrainer.NasBertOptions)
FreezeTransfer

Se os parâmetros de módulo de transferência devem ser congelados.

(Herdado de NasBertTrainer.NasBertOptions)
LabelColumnName

O nome da coluna do rótulo.

(Herdado de TorchSharpBaseTrainer.Options)
LayerNormTraining

Se deseja treinar parâmetros de norma de camada.

(Herdado de NasBertTrainer.NasBertOptions)
LearningRate

Taxa de aprendizado para as primeiras épocas N; todas as épocas >N usando LR_N. Observação: isso pode ser interpretado de forma diferente dependendo do agendador.

(Herdado de NasBertTrainer.NasBertOptions)
MaxEpoch

Pare o treinamento ao atingir esse número de épocas.

(Herdado de TorchSharpBaseTrainer.Options)
PoolerDropout

Taxa de descarte nas camadas do pooler de modelo de linguagem mascarada. Deve estar dentro de [0, 1).

(Herdado de NasBertTrainer.NasBertOptions)
PredictionColumnName

O nome da coluna Previsão.

(Herdado de TorchSharpBaseTrainer.Options)
ScoreColumnName

O nome da coluna Pontuar.

(Herdado de TorchSharpBaseTrainer.Options)
Sentence1ColumnName

A primeira coluna de frase.

(Herdado de NasBertTrainer.NasBertOptions)
Sentence2ColumnName

A segunda coluna de frase.

(Herdado de NasBertTrainer.NasBertOptions)
StartLearningRateRatio

A taxa de aprendizado inicial para o agendador de decaimento polinomial.

(Herdado de TorchSharpBaseTrainer.Options)
TaskType

Tipo de tarefa, que está relacionado ao cabeçalho do modelo.

(Herdado de NasBertTrainer.NasBertOptions)
ValidationSet

O conjunto de validação usado durante o treinamento para melhorar a qualidade do modelo.

(Herdado de TorchSharpBaseTrainer.Options)
WarmupRatio

Proporção de etapas de aquecimento para o agendador de decaimento polinomial.

(Herdado de NasBertTrainer.NasBertOptions)
WeightDecay

Coefficiency de decadência de peso. Deve estar dentro de [0, +Inf).

(Herdado de TorchSharpBaseTrainer.Options)

Aplica-se a